Finance Review Summary — Skyrell Launch Plan

The Skyrell launch remains on budget. Marketing spend is front-loaded into the first six weeks; inventory staging for the Brockhaven branches completes this month. Break-even is projected at month nine under base-case volumes. Branch managers should hold discretionary spend until launch. The confidential strategic note follows below.

board note of bawep-tajef: Queniusek Systems plans to raise the Quenvan list price by 53.1 percent in March. The pricing group signed off on a budget of $176.4 million for Project Drueth. The renewal with Casionix Partners closes at $142.5 million a year, 8.3 percent below the last contract. Project Fraax slips by six weeks because of the tooling delay.

// Snapshot test client for the Glimmerkit UI component library.
// This talks to the Pixelvault diffing service, which stores golden
// renders per component per theme. Snapshots are keyed on component
// hash, so renaming a component orphans its goldens — run the prune
// job afterwards. CI uses a read-write credential; local runs should
// be read-only unless updating baselines intentionally. The client
// authenticates to Pixelvault with the key below.

API key for kahop-bagef: zpat2_yb

**Ticket: Experiment assignment service returning default buckets**

The Pebbleflux assignment service in the canary environment is handing every user the control bucket. Root cause: the env file shipped without the config-fetch settings, so the service falls back to defaults silently. Restore EXPERIMENT_CONFIG_URL and the fetch interval, then restart the pods. The fetcher also needs its API credential, which goes on the next line of the file.

vault entry, yahif-yajep: COURIER_KEY29=b802bdf8034096b65a51c6ba5abe2

- [ ] Key ceremony step 4 (Cronfall migration)

Support: we're moving the nightly cron jobs into the Lanternway workflow engine this week. During the ceremony, confirm the old scheduler box is fenced off and that Lanternway owns all retry logic. Do not re-enable crontab entries afterward. If the workflow vault refuses the new key, use break-glass. The recovery passphrase you'll need is listed immediately below.

vault phrase of bawig-kajop = aldeth-eliael-giliel-lamael